After an incredibly enjoyable time touring around Sri Lanka, it was time for the luxurious paradise of the OBLU Select Sangeli, which we reached by a 50-minute comfortable boat ride to the island.

The place blew us away upon arrival. Everything looked stunning, from the gorgeous beaches, crystal clear water, spectacular water villas, and all the lovely palms. The bars and the pool looked perfect too, which didn’t take very long to confirm this was the case.

Staying in a Water Villa was a first for us and we would definitely do so again. To look out into the open sea was amazing, along with being able to see the fish swimming beneath us through the internal glass floor.

Steps from the balcony meant we could climb down into the sea and a short distance out was a drop, so you could see deep down into the ocean and a stunning collection of spectacular fish.

The resort service was superb - all the staff went above and beyond even the cleaning team, who would ask daily if there was anything that we wanted in the room.

There was no need to leave the hotel at all. We stayed on an all-inclusive basis and the three restaurants, two of which were à la carte, were of a very high standard.

We went scuba diving, out on jet skis with a guide to see other islands and to a sandbar in the middle of the ocean, which was a great experience. We also went canoeing, snorkelled outside the villa daily, watched dolphins swim by and saw some gorgeous sunsets - words can’t explain the feelings.
